VANCOUVER – Choom Holdings Inc. (the “Company” or “Choom”) (CSE: CHOO; OTCQB: CHOOF), an emerging adult use cannabis company that has secured one of the largest national retail networks in Canada, is pleased to announce that further to its news release of December 20, 2019, it has completed a non-brokered private placement of debenture units at $250,000 per unit for gross proceeds of $4,100,000 million (the “Offering”).

The debentures will mature on December 23, 2021, subject to the rights of a holder to extend the term up to a further 12 months, and will accrue interest at the rate of 10% per annum, payable semi-annually. At a holder’s option, the Debentures may be converted into common shares of Choom at a conversion price of $0.15. Under the Offering, the Company also issued 1,666,666 transferable common share purchase warrants per debenture unit, each such warrant to be exercisable to acquire one Common Share for a four-year period at an exercise price of $0.20 per share.

The net proceeds of the offering will be used for store buildouts, general working capital purposes and inventory purchases. The Debentures, warrants and any shares issued either on conversion or exercise will be subject to a four month hold period under applicable provincial securities laws in Canada, ending on April 24, 2020.

Two related parties of the Company participated in the Offering and acquired debenture units for $2.1 million. Such participation constituted a “related party transaction” within the meaning of Multilateral Instrument 61-101 Protection of Minority Security Holders in Special Transactions (“MI 61-101”). The issuance to the Related Parties is exempt from the formal valuation and minority shareholder approval requirements of MI 61-101 in respect of related party participation in the Offering as neither the fair market value (as determined under MI 61-101) of the subject matter of, nor the fair market value of the consideration for, the transaction, insofar as it involves interested parties, exceeded 25% of the Company’s market capitalization.

About Choom
Choom is an emerging adult use cannabis company whose mission is to establish one of the largest retail networks in Canada. The Choom brand is inspired by Hawaii’s “Choom Gang”—a group of buddies in Honolulu during the 1970’s who loved to smoke weed—or as the locals called it, “Choom”. Evoking the spirit of the original Choom Gang, our brand caters to the Canadian adult use market with the ethos of ‘cultivating good times’.

Choom is focused on delivering an elevated customer experience through our curated retail environments, offering a diversity of brands for Canadians across a national retail network.
